    Poly's technological edge is defined by its Acoustic Fence and NoiseBlockAI technologies. Acoustic Fence uses advanced beamforming microphones to create a virtual "fence" around the meeting, selectively picking up voices within that zone while aggressively rejecting noise from outside it. NoiseBlockAI leverages machine learning to identify and suppress disruptive background sounds like keyboard clicks, paper shuffling, and even barking dogs in real-time.     Audio Quality (Frequency Response, Noise Cancellation)

    Audio quality is the non-negotiable foundation of any conference speaker. It's determined by two key technical aspects: frequency response and noise cancellation. A wide frequency response (e.g., 50Hz-20kHz) ensures that voices sound natural and full, capturing both low-end warmth and high-end clarity. More crucial for conference calls is the speaker's ability to suppress unwanted noise. Advanced noise cancellation uses digital signal processing (DSP) algorithms to identify and filter out ambient sounds like keyboard clatter, air conditioning hum, or background conversation. This ensures that only the speaker's voice is transmitted clearly. Some high-end models feature adaptive noise cancellation that adjusts in real-time based on the environment. For professionals in Hong Kong's often dense and noisy office environments, this feature is invaluable for maintaining call professionalism.

    Microphone Array (Number of Mics, Pickup Range)

    The microphone system is what distinguishes a conference speaker from a standard Bluetooth speaker. Most quality units employ a beamforming microphone array—typically consisting of 2 to 8 individual microphones. This array works in concert to create a focused "beam" of sensitivity that picks up voices from around the room while minimizing sound from other directions. The pickup range, often stated as 360-degree coverage with a radius of 2 to 4 meters, defines the effective meeting area. A larger array (e.g., 4+ mics) generally provides better voice isolation and a wider, more consistent pickup pattern. This technology is what allows a to clearly capture everyone seated around a table without requiring a central, obtrusive microphone.

    Battery Life (Talk Time, Charging Time)

    True portability is defined by battery performance. Key metrics are talk time (continuous call time on a single charge) and charging time. For 2024, a competitive device should offer a minimum of 10-15 hours of talk time, ensuring it can last through a full day of back-to-back meetings. Charging technology is equally important; fast charging via USB-C can provide several hours of use from a short 15-minute charge. Some models also support "bus-powered" operation, meaning they can function while charging, which is perfect for all-day meetings in a fixed location. When evaluating, consider your typical meeting patterns—frequent travelers will prioritize maximum battery life, while desk-bound users might value bus-powered flexibility more.

    Connectivity Options (Bluetooth Version, USB Type)

    Connectivity dictates how easily the speaker integrates into your tech stack. Bluetooth 5.0 or higher is now standard, offering improved range, stability, and lower power consumption compared to older versions. However, wired options remain critical for reliability. Look for a USB-C port that serves dual purposes: for firmware updates and as a digital audio interface (USB DAC mode) for a pristine, lag-free connection to your computer. A 3.5mm AUX-in jack is a useful fallback. Some advanced models may also include HDMI output for video. The best devices offer multiple connection pathways to ensure compatibility with any laptop, tablet, or smartphone.

    What is a PTZ Camera?

    A PTZ camera is a high-performance video camera that supports remote directional and zoom control. The acronym stands for Pan, Tilt, and Zoom, which are its three core mechanical functions. Pan refers to the horizontal rotation of the camera (left and right). Tilt is the vertical movement (up and down). Zoom is the ability to magnify the image optically, bringing distant subjects closer without sacrificing image quality, unlike digital zoom which simply crops the image. These cameras are built with robust, silent motors that allow for smooth, precise movements. Originally developed for security and surveillance, PTZ technology has been refined and adopted by the broadcasting and live streaming industries for its operational flexibility. Modern PTZ cameras for streaming often include features like auto-focus, auto-exposure, and sometimes even auto-framing or subject tracking, making them incredibly smart tools for solo operators or small production teams.

    Key Features of PTZ Cameras (Pan, Tilt, Zoom)

    Understanding the depth of each PTZ function is crucial for selecting the right model. Pan Range: This is typically expressed in degrees (e.g., ±170° pan). A wider pan range offers more coverage, essential for large rooms or stages. Tilt Range: Similarly, a good tilt range (e.g., -30° to +90°) allows you to capture everything from a low-angle shot to a high-angle overview. Zoom Power: This is arguably the most critical spec. Optical zoom, measured in a factor like 12x, 20x, or 30x, uses the lens's optics to magnify. A 20x optical zoom is a standard for mid-range streaming PTZ cameras, offering significant flexibility. Some specs also list a "Digital Zoom" number, but for quality streaming, optical zoom is the primary concern. Beyond the core PTZ functions, other key features include preset positions (the ability to save and recall specific pan, tilt, and zoom settings instantly), remote control protocols (VISCA over IP, RS-232, RS-422), and video output interfaces.

    Image Quality and Resolution (1080p, 4K)

    Resolution is the starting point for image quality. For Zoom, which supports up to 1080p video, a 1080p PTZ camera is sufficient. However, investing in a 4K PTZ camera offers significant advantages even if the final stream is 1080p. The higher resolution sensor provides more detail, allowing you to digitally zoom or crop the image in post-production or in your streaming software without noticeable quality loss. It also future-proofs your setup. When selecting, also consider the sensor size (e.g., 1/2.3", 1/2.8")—generally, a larger sensor captures more light, improving low-light performance. Look for features like Wide Dynamic Range (WDR) or HDR, which help balance scenes with both bright and dark areas, common in rooms with windows. ptz camera with microphone manufacturer

    Optical Zoom Capabilities

    Optical zoom is a defining feature. For a small meeting room, a 10x zoom may be ample. For a lecture hall, church, or large event space, 20x or 30x optical zoom is necessary to get clean close-ups of speakers from the back of the room. Always prioritize optical zoom over digital zoom. A common mistake is to be swayed by a "300x total zoom" figure that includes digital zoom; the image becomes unusably pixelated at high digital zoom levels. For versatile , a 12x to 20x optical zoom is the sweet spot for most applications.

    Connectivity Options (USB, HDMI, SDI, IP)

    Connectivity determines how the camera integrates into your system. USB: The simplest for Zoom, plug-and-play. Ideal for direct connection to a computer. HDMI: Outputs a clean, uncompressed video signal to a capture card, which then feeds into the computer. This often provides lower latency and higher quality than USB. SDI: A professional broadcast standard. SDI cables can run much longer distances (100m+) without signal loss compared to HDMI, crucial for large venues. IP (Network): Allows the camera to connect via Ethernet. Video and control signals are sent over the network, enabling remote control from anywhere and easy integration into larger IP-based production systems. Many cameras offer a combination, like USB+HDMI, for maximum flexibility.

    Audio Input/Output

    While Zoom primarily uses computer or external USB microphones for audio, a PTZ camera with integrated or input audio can simplify setups. Some models have a built-in microphone, useful for backup audio or in very small spaces. More importantly, look for a camera with a 3.5mm mic input or, even better, an XLR input with phantom power. This allows you to connect a high-quality shotgun or lavalier microphone directly to the camera. The audio is then embedded into the video signal (via HDMI/SDI) or sent through USB, creating a synchronized audio/video source for Zoom. This is a key feature for those seeking a streamlined setup from a reputable .

    Control Options (Remote Control, Software, Joystick)

    Control is what makes a PTZ camera powerful. Included IR Remote: Basic but useful for simple presets and direct control. Dedicated Hardware Controller/Joystick: Offers the most precise, tactile control over pan, tilt, zoom, and focus. Essential for live, manual camera operation. Software Control: Manufacturers provide desktop or web-based applications for full control, including setting presets, adjusting image parameters (exposure, white balance), and updating firmware. Many cameras also support third-party control protocols (VISCA, Pelco-D, NDI|PTZ) allowing integration into broadcast control systems or software like OBS.

    Low Light Performance

    Not all streaming environments have perfect studio lighting. A camera's low-light performance is determined by its sensor size, lens aperture (a lower f-number like f/1.8 is better), and image processing. Look for a specification called "Minimum Illumination" (e.g., 0.5 lux). The lower this number, the better the camera can see in the dark. Features like noise reduction and a slow shutter mode can also help in dimly lit venues like concert halls or churches, ensuring your stream remains clear and professional.

    Connecting the Camera to Your Computer

    The connection method depends on your camera's outputs. For the simplest setup, use a USB cable (if the camera supports USB video output). Plug it directly into your computer. For higher quality or longer distances, use the HDMI or SDI output connected to an external capture card (e.g., from Elgato, Blackmagic Design, or AVerMedia), which then connects to your computer via USB. Install any necessary drivers for the camera or capture card. Once connected, the camera should appear as a selectable video source in Zoom. For IP cameras, you may need to use the manufacturer's software to encode the video stream into a format that appears as a virtual webcam on your system.

    Configuring Zoom Settings for Optimal Performance

    In Zoom, go to Settings > Video. Select your PTZ camera as the camera source. Click "Advanced" and consider enabling the following for a professional stream: HD Video: Enable "720p" or "1080p" if available (depends on your Zoom plan). Touch up my appearance: Use sparingly. Adjust for low light: It's better to fix the lighting physically, but this can help in a pinch. Video filters: Generally disable for a professional look. More importantly, in the meeting itself, right-click your video and select "Video Settings" to access the controls without leaving the meeting. Here, you can ensure your framing is correct. If using the camera's audio, also select it as the microphone source in Zoom's audio settings.

    Presets and Automations

    Presets are the most powerful feature for a solo operator. Before your event, frame shots for each key location (Host, Guest 1, Wide Shot, Product Shot) and save them as Preset 1, 2, 3, etc. During the live stream, you can switch between these perfect frames instantly using a remote, joystick, or software hotkey. Some advanced software allows for automations: you can program a "tour" where the camera cycles through presets at timed intervals, or use serial commands to trigger presets from other devices. This automation is what enables one person to produce a dynamic, multi-angle-looking stream.

    Multi-Camera Setups

    For more complex productions, you can use multiple PTZ cameras. Connect each to its own capture card or use an IP network. To switch between them in Zoom, you have two main options: Use external streaming software like OBS Studio or vMix as a virtual camera. These programs allow you to switch between camera feeds, add graphics, and then output a single, polished video feed to Zoom. Alternatively, some advanced USB PTZ cameras allow you to connect several to one computer and switch between them using the manufacturer's software, which then presents as a single video source to Zoom.

    Integrating with Streaming Software (OBS, vMix)

    For maximum production control, using dedicated streaming software is recommended. OBS Studio (free) and vMix (paid) are industry standards. Add each PTZ camera as a video source in the software. You can then create scenes—e.g., "Scene 1: Host Cam," "Scene 2: Guest Cam," "Scene 3: Screen Share." Add lower thirds, transitions, and other graphics. The software outputs a final composite video through a "Virtual Camera" feature, which you then select as your camera source in Zoom. This method separates the production complexity from Zoom, giving you broadcast-level control over your output.

    Camera Not Recognized by Zoom

    If Zoom doesn't see your camera, first ensure all cables are securely connected. Try a different USB port, preferably a USB 3.0 port. Restart Zoom and your computer. Check if the camera is recognized by other software (like the manufacturer's app or OBS). If using a capture card, ensure its drivers are installed and it's recognized by your operating system. For IP cameras, ensure the streaming application is running and the virtual camera driver is installed. Sometimes, security software can block camera access; check your permissions.

    Poor Image Quality

    If the image is blurry, soft, or pixelated, check the following: Ensure Zoom is set to the highest resolution (in Video Settings > Advanced). Verify your internet connection speed is sufficient for the selected resolution. If using a capture card, ensure it's configured for the correct input resolution. Check the camera's focus—it may be in auto-focus hunt mode; switch to manual focus and adjust. Clean the camera lens. Ensure adequate lighting on your subject; poor lighting forces the camera to increase gain (ISO), introducing noise.

    Audio Problems

    If using the camera's audio input and no sound is heard in Zoom, first ensure the correct microphone is selected in Zoom's audio settings. Check the physical connection of the microphone to the camera. Ensure the microphone is powered (if needed) and not muted. In the camera's control software, verify the audio input level is not set to zero. Test the microphone with another device to rule out hardware failure. If using an external USB mic alongside the PTZ camera, ensure Zoom is set to use the USB mic, not the camera's audio.
